LeetCode - 1480(JS, Easy)

진영·2024년 4월 1일
0

LeetCode

목록 보기
4/16

1480. Running Sum of 1d Array

난이도: Easy

문제 설명

Given an array nums. We define a running sum of an array as
runningSum[i] = sum(nums[0]…nums[i]).
Return the running sum of nums.

해설

배열 nums가 입력되고 새로운 배열 runningSum을 만드는데
runningSum의 i번째 요소가 sum(nums[0]...nums[i])여야 한다.
구한 runningSum을 반환하면 된다.

정답

/**
 * @param {number[]} nums
 * @return {number[]}
 */
var runningSum = function(nums) {
    let arr = []
    let sum = 0;
    for(let i = 0; i < nums.length; i++){
        sum += nums[i];
        arr.push(sum);
    }

    return arr;
};
profile
개발하고 만드는걸 좋아합니다

0개의 댓글

관련 채용 정보